#1c04a6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c04a6 is composed of 11% red, 1.6% green and 65.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.1% cyan, 97.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 248.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 33.3%. #1c04a6 color hex could be obtained by blending #3808ff with #00004d.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#1c04a6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c04a6 has RGB values of R:28, G:4, B:166 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 1836198.
